Output d84227a66ea84ed71532ff8925b6d4fcf0265d1609b0bbcbfb3c293d8405d9cb:1

value
1003070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f21fef75e41313ec94f25c077c18b194c379ec OP_EQUAL
address
384rbuJ5uhVZW7ZdFYy8UEY1zzKEUc4D7C
transaction
d84227a66ea84ed71532ff8925b6d4fcf0265d1609b0bbcbfb3c293d8405d9cb
confirmations
318905
spent
true